This constant change in scenery makes the Salkantay Trek a unique alternative to traditional routes and one of the most scenic trekking experiences in South America.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"712\" data-end=\"748\">Along the trail, visitors can enjoy:<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"750\" data-end=\"982\">\n<li data-section-id=\"mwu1al\" data-start=\"750\" data-end=\"779\">Stunning mountain panoramas<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"ulwmlf\" data-start=\"780\" data-end=\"809\">Crystal-clear glacial lakes<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"1oeb0l1\" data-start=\"810\" data-end=\"833\">Remote Andean valleys<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"1yb9rg2\" data-start=\"834\" data-end=\"859\">Diverse flora and fauna<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"asm3xa\" data-start=\"860\" data-end=\"893\">Traditional farming communities<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"z9hha\" data-start=\"894\" data-end=\"933\">Cloud forests and tropical vegetation<\/li>\n<li data-section-id=\"qwwu9w\" data-start=\"934\" data-end=\"982\">Unforgettable views on the way to Machu Picchu<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2 data-section-id=\"1pg41br\" data-start=\"984\" data-end=\"1039\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Apu_Salkantay_The_Sacred_Guardian_of_the_Andes\"><\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/es.wikipedia.org\/wiki\/Apu_(divinidad)\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Apu<\/a> Salkantay: The Sacred Guardian of the Andes<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p data-start=\"1041\" data-end=\"1355\">The trek takes its name from the impressive <span class=\"hover:entity-accent entity-underline inline cursor-pointer align-baseline\"><span class=\"whitespace-normal\">Salkantay Mountain<\/span><\/span>, one of the most important and majestic peaks in Peru. Rising to approximately 6,271 meters (20,574 feet) above sea level, Salkantay dominates the surrounding landscape with its towering glaciers and permanently snow-covered summit.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"1357\" data-end=\"1664\">For centuries, local Quechua communities have considered Salkantay a sacred Apu, or mountain spirit, believed to protect the valleys and people living in the region. Its spiritual significance, combined with its breathtaking natural beauty, has made it one of the most respected mountains in Andean culture.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"1666\" data-end=\"1924\">The opportunity to trek beneath this magnificent peak is one of the highlights of the journey. Salkantay Trek is not only a journey through spectacular landscapes but also an opportunity to discover the living culture of the Andes. Along the route, travelers pass through small mountain communities where families continue to preserve traditions that have been part of their way of life for centuries.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"360\" data-end=\"761\">Many local residents rely on traditional agriculture, cultivating crops such as potatoes, corn, and quinoa on the fertile slopes of the Andes. Alpaca and llama herding remains an important activity, while skilled artisans create beautiful textiles using techniques passed down through generations. Visitors may also hear Quechua, the ancient language of the Incas, still spoken in many villages today.<\/p>\n<p data-start=\"763\" data-end=\"947\">These encounters provide a unique cultural dimension to the trek, allowing travelers to gain a deeper appreciation for the traditions, hospitality, and resilience of the Andean people.<\/p>\n<h2 data-section-id=\"jhqf8l\" data-start=\"949\" data-end=\"988\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Sustainable_Tourism_and_Conservation\"><\/span>Sustainable Tourism and Conservation<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p data-start=\"990\" data-end=\"1301\">As more travelers choose the Salkantay Trek as their route to Machu Picchu, sustainable tourism has become essential for protecting both the environment and local communities.
